Mumbai University Third Merit List 2025: Mumbai University is scheduled to announce the third merit list for undergraduate (UG) admissions 2025 tomorrow, June 5, 2025. Candidates who have registered in different undergraduate programs can read and download the MU Second merit list at muugadmission.samarth.edu.in. Around 7:00 PM, the University of Mumbai is anticipated to make the third merit list public.

The revised timeline for document verification and the start of classes should be reviewed by candidates who are waiting for the next step of the admissions process. June 13, 2025, will be the first day of courses.

Mumbai University Third Merit List 2025: Steps to check the list

Students can easily access and download the Mumbai University third merit list 2025 by following these steps:

Step 1: Go to the college's official website to submit your application.

Step 2: On the site or Admission page, look for the "Admissions 2025-26" or "Merit List" section. Usually, this appears as a banner or beneath the tab for the most recent news and updates.

Step 3: Select the link to the Mumbai University Third Merit List.

Step 4: Look up your name, application number, or category in the Mumbai University third merit PDF.

Mumbai University Third Merit List 2025: Fourth merit list

A fourth merit list is only made in specific situations and is not always announced. Depending on variables like the number of open seats after the third round or late student registrations, a fourth list may be possible.

The issuance of a fourth merit list in 2025 has not yet been formally announced by Mumbai University. For the most recent information and announcements on admissions, students are encouraged to frequently visit both the official MU admission portal and the websites of individual colleges.

Mumbai University Third Merit List 2025: What's next?

Shortlisted students must complete the admissions process to guarantee their seats following the release of the merit list. This entails showing up at the designated institution on the designated days, paying the entrance fee by the deadline to prevent cancellation, and completing any other requirements the college may have, such as completing forms or attending orientation sessions.
